This has been going on for years bro. It's the multiple factors of getting rid of the winter field cuttings by burning in the Punjab and Haryana, the low pressure front that tends to be prevalent around this time of year and poor people burning anything they can find to stay warm.

Also Diwali fireworks.
A factor yes, but probably contributing to less than 5% of the problem. We banned sale of crackers last year and situation wasn't much better than what it is now. This year people were given just a 2 hour window to burn crackers and while some idiots did burn crackers, that cannot make the situation even close enough to what we are experiencing.
